IPL photofacials
Intense-pulsed light is a form of laser treatment, with high energy light. They are used to treat various skin diseases, in order to eliminate or reduce the appearance of acne scars, freckles, sun spots, broken capillaries, spider veins, birthmarks, and even facial redness due to rosacea or other conditions. These facials can be used to produce a more youthful appearance.

LED or LED Light Therapy Photo Face
On the other hand, the light-emitting diode (LED) photo facial are mild, with no risk of treatment. LED photo facials use red and infrared light that will not burn or irritate the skin. There are two advantages of LED photo facial. First, the blue LED light therapy can be used to kill or disrupt the acne-causing bacteria to reduce facial acne. Second, as with IPL photo facial, red and infrared light enters the cells beneath the surface of the skin, stimulates collagen production for production of the skin with more elasticity and fewer wrinkles.
